As we get older, a normal part of
aging is bone loss. Aging begins
after growth stops. For the skeleton, peak bone mass is usually achieved
in the middle of the third decade and
plateaus for about 10 years. After this
point, more bone tissue will be broken
down or dissolved than will be rebuilt
due to the dynamic nature of bone metabolism.
